The vulnerability in the checkout.c component of the Git method implementation in the Libgit2 C language allows a perpetrator to access confidential data, compromise its integrity, and cause service failures.

Libgit2 checkout.c vulnerability lets remote attackers access data, compromise integrity, and disrupt services via a bad reference name.
